Montana is a beautiful state with a lot to offer newcomers. If you're thinking of relocating to Missoula, Montana, here are a few things to keep in mind.
The cost of living in Montana is relatively affordable, especially when compared to other Western states. However, housing costs can vary widely depending on the city or town you choose to live in.
Montana's climate varies depending on the region, but generally speaking, the state has four distinct seasons. Winter can be harsh in some parts of the state, so be prepared for snow and cold weather if you're moving from a warmer climate.
Montana is home to many different outdoor activities and attractions. From hiking and camping in the summer to skiing and snowboarding in the winter, there's always something to do. Montana is also home to numerous national parks and monuments, so there's plenty of opportunity to explore the great outdoors.
If you're looking for a change of pace, Missoula, Montana might be the perfect place for you. With its beautiful scenery and friendly people, Montana is a great state to call home.
